Output 2e31a27c2090146bf3a10e5fa51a34550312d4a0cceb5339e87cfd5f6e50b776:4

value
653212340
script pubkey
OP_0 OP_PUSHBYTES_32 1efdf041b873e4d86a7192fa79121c297a0f9a3962e575ee52b88270a095de2b
address
bc1qrm7lqsdcw0jds6n3jta8jysu99aqlx3evtjhtmjjhzp8pgy4mc4staqazk
transaction
2e31a27c2090146bf3a10e5fa51a34550312d4a0cceb5339e87cfd5f6e50b776